Pregnancy is a remarkable journey filled with anticipation and excitement, and modern technology allows expecting parents to catch a glimpse of their baby’s world through 3D ultrasound imaging. While the prospect of seeing your little one in detail is undoubtedly thrilling, there’s a simple yet crucial preparation step often overlooked – staying well-hydrated. In this blog post, we’ll explore why drinking water is so important before your 3D ultrasound appointment.

Clearer Images:

One of the primary reasons 3D ultrasound studios recommend drinking water before a 3D ultrasound is to ensure clearer images. Adequate hydration helps improve the amniotic fluid levels around the baby. Amniotic fluid acts as a medium through which sound waves travel during the ultrasound, creating the images you’ll cherish. When the amniotic fluid levels are optimal, it enhances the clarity and resolution of the images, providing a more detailed view of your baby’s features.

Positioning Assistance:

Hydration not only benefits the quality of images but also aids in the baby’s positioning during the ultrasound. Ample amniotic fluid allows the baby to move more freely, making it easier for the sonographer to capture various angles and aspects of your baby’s development. This can be especially crucial if you’re hoping to get a good look at specific features, such as the face or hands.

Enhanced Diagnostic Capabilities:

In some cases, 3D ultrasounds are used for medical purposes to assess the baby’s health and development. Proper hydration ensures that the ultrasound technologist can obtain the necessary images to make accurate assessments. This is particularly important if your healthcare provider has recommended a 3D ultrasound for medical reasons, such as facial anomalies, like cleft lip.
